Monsoon Flooding in West Texas?

The extensive rains across northern Mexico and West Texas from the retreating North American monsoon are bringing historic flooding to the Rio Conchos and Rio Grande. As reservoirs on the Rio Conchos overflow, the downstream cities of Ojinaga (in Chihuahua, Mexico) and Presidio (in Texas) have watched flood waters breach their levees. The deaths of the U.S. and Mexican directors of the International Boundary Waters Commission and Rio Grande Council of Governments in a plane crash while surveying the flood have added to the tragedy.
